Topdrop is a state of emotional and physical depletion experienced by a dominant partner following an intense BDSM scene or extended period of topspace. Unlike subdrop, which describes the neurochemical crash a submissive may experience after intense play, Topdrop affects the person in the dominant role and stems from the psychological and emotional labour of maintaining control, responsibility, and presence throughout a scene. The condition manifests as fatigue, emotional numbness, mild depression, or anxiety, typically emerging hours or days after a scene concludes. Topdrop is distinct from simple tiredness; it reflects the specific neurochemical shifts that occur when a dominant exits the focused, heightened mental state known as topspace. The phenomenon is closely related to what some practitioners call "Domspace crash" or "Dom drop," though Topdrop has become the more widely adopted term in contemporary kink communities. Recognising Topdrop as a legitimate physiological and psychological response—rather than weakness or lack of aftercare—is essential to maintaining consent and emotional safety in BDSM relationships.
In practice, Topdrop management begins with negotiation and realistic scene planning. Experienced Tops discuss their own triggers, capacity, and recovery needs with their partners before a scene, setting expectations around aftercare that benefits both parties rather than only the submissive. Common recommendations include scheduling recovery time after intense scenes, maintaining physical contact and emotional connection during the hours following play, and avoiding major decisions or social commitments immediately after intense dynamics. Many practitioners find that topping while already fatigued or emotionally depleted increases Topdrop severity, making regular self-care and boundaries essential. Partners often ask whether Topdrop is avoidable or dangerous; the answer is that while some intensity of drop is normal, open communication and mutual aftercare significantly reduce its severity and duration. The key distinction from regular fatigue is that Topdrop involves a specific emotional dip tied to exiting topspace, rather than simple physical tiredness. Some Tops experience Topdrop as a gentle letdown lasting a few hours, while others report deeper drops lasting several days, especially after particularly prolonged or emotionally demanding scenes. Recognising your own Topdrop pattern and communicating it to partners ensures both people can plan adequate recovery and support.
